file-type

DM数据库配置详解:控制文件、数据文件与日志文件

PDF文件

下载需积分: 24 | 4.79MB | 更新于2024-08-07 | 153 浏览量 | 17 下载量 举报 收藏
download 立即下载
"数据库文件路径设置、控制文件、数据文件、日志文件在数据库管理和运维中的重要性,以及达梦数据库(DBA)的相关知识" 在数据库管理中,正确配置数据库文件路径是确保系统稳定性和数据安全性的重要环节。本文主要探讨了非线性规划的背景,并以达梦数据库为例,讲解了相关设置。 首先,控制文件是数据库的核心组件,它存储了关于数据库结构的关键信息,如主要数据文件路径、日志文件路径和LSN(日志序列号)等。控制文件不是普通的文本文件,而是二进制文件,一旦创建后不宜随意更改。由于其重要性,控制文件需要多份镜像以防止丢失或损坏。在DM数据库中,可以在创建数据库时指定多个控制文件的镜像,这样当某个控制文件出现问题时,可以通过其他镜像恢复。 数据文件是数据库中实际存储数据的部分,它们包含了系统表空间、用户表空间、回滚表空间等路径。数据文件可以有多个镜像以提高容错能力。数据文件由一系列相同大小的数据页组成,数据页是磁盘I/O和缓冲区管理的基本单位。簇是数据文件内连续的存储空间,由固定数量的数据页构成,数据库以簇为单位分配空间,提高效率。 日志文件,尤其是重做日志文件,对数据库的事务处理和恢复至关重要。它们记录了数据库的所有事务操作,以便在系统崩溃或故障后能恢复到一致性状态。DM数据库的重做日志文件用于存储事务日志,而归档日志文件则用于长期保留这些日志,以满足审计和灾难恢复需求。 此外,了解数据库的逻辑和物理存储结构也是DBA必备的知识。逻辑存储结构包括表空间、记录、页、簇和段,而物理存储结构涉及配置文件、控制文件、数据文件、重做日志文件等多个方面。内存结构,如缓冲区、排序区、哈希区等,以及线程管理,如监听线程、工作线程、日志归档线程等,都是数据库高效运行的关键因素。 对数据库文件路径的设置,以及对控制文件、数据文件和日志文件的理解和管理,是达梦数据库DBA日常工作中不可或缺的部分,这些知识和技能有助于确保数据库的稳定运行和数据的安全。

相关推荐

半夏256
  • 粉丝: 19
上传资源 快速赚钱